    Bravo 3 gimbal ring moves up about 1/8" with swivel shaft. Any easy fix?

    Either your ring is worn or the washers which go between them are worn. Should have between 0.001 to 0.010 clearance with the tiller handle tight. To get at the nut you either need to pull the motor or drill holes in the upper section of the transom assembly for access

    2000 7.4l MEP intermittent alarm

    Your correct the MEFI 3 has the knock sensor built into the ECM. If your ECM is set up for two knock sensors and only one is connected you will get the same error. Note L29 engine is the only one which used two sensors. What is the part number on your ECM?
